Shares of Exxon Mobil Corp. (XOM) slid 1.63% to $152.51 Friday, on what proved to be an all-around dismal trading session for the stock market, with the S&P 500 Index falling 0.11% to 6,816.89 and Dow Jones Industrial Average falling 0.56% to 47,916.57.
This was the stock's third consecutive day of losses.
Exxon Mobil Corp. closed 13.55% short of its 52-week high of $176.41, which the company achieved on March 30th.
The stock underperformed when compared to some of its competitors Friday, as Chevron Corp. $(CVX)$ fell 0.95% to $188.55 and ConocoPhillips $(COP)$ fell 0.75% to $122.55.
Trading volume (21.0 M) remained 3.2 million below its 50-day average volume of 24.2 M.
